Patricia was known for her loving and generous spirit, dedicating much of her life to her family. Patricia leaves behind her devoted husband of 47 years, John Pendergrass, her cherished daughter, Betty Pendergrass (Mike House), and sons JJ Pendergrass (Laura Pendergrass), and Alfred Pendergrass, and wonderful, dedicated sister, Mary Evans (Dan Odom). Patricia was a proud grandmother to Christina Scott, Justin House, Jamie Pendergrass, Joshua Pendergrass and Hayden Stockinger, Great Grandmother to Leanna Jobe and Jaxon Davis, an aunt to nieces, great nieces and nephews. Patricia was preceded in death by her parents, Peggy and Guy Davis, and her brother, Guy Davis, Jr.
A gathering to honor Patricia's life and legacy will be held Wednesday, July 2, 2025 at 12:00 PM in the Chapel of Cornerstone Funeral Home with Pastor Johnny Hudson officiating for family and friends to pay their respects and share memories. Visitation will be one hour prior to service. Burial will follow at Mill Branch Cemetery. Patricia's kindness and warmth will be missed by all who knew her.
